You may not get paid back, or if it's returned but it takes a long time, your relationship may crack under the pressure. … Web6. apr 2024 · If you lend money to a relative or friend with the understanding the relative or friend may not repay it, you must consider it as a gift and not as a loan, and you may not deduct it as a bad debt. There are two kinds of bad debts – business and nonbusiness.
